View Full Details of Forest ViewMy mother has been a resident at Forest View for three years. She now has advanced dementia but throughout her stay she has always been cared for with compassion and kindness. As her needs have changed, the management and staff have adjusted things to help her live as comfortably as possible and to keep her occupied when she could no longer join in with the communal activities. The family who own Forest View are very hands on with the day to day care and running of the home and I think their caring attitude runs right through to all the wonderful members of staff. The home itself is very well kept, always clean and airy, with nicely furnished rooms. The garden has a mix of flower beds, seats and wheelchair friendly paths, and is a lovely place to spend some time outdoors. We are so glad we found Forest View when we needed it, and we could not have found a better home for Mum

My dad has been a resident here since early 2022. Prior to this he spent a year in a home that he was clearly not happy in and where his family struggled to gain access to visit him. This place is so different from the previous one and I am still so incredibly grateful that we waited to get him in here. I'll be honest and say he didn't initially settle well, and more honestly, I was asked to find him somewhere else ASAP. Not the best first impression for both parties. However through a difficult period a strong relationship between our family and the home was formed. My dad settled down and was allowed to stay. From that point I can only lavish praise on the owners for their dedication to improving the facilities, maintaining a consistent team of very caring staff, and bringing activities in from outside to engage the residents where they can. The door is always open, staff are always on hand and happy to help. Thank you Forest View, my dad is very much at home with you.

Our experience of our loved one's care at Forest View was unfortunately, not at all positive and they are now residing at a care home that is able to provide an appropriate standard of care. Our loved one's health deteriorated rapidly and in addition to local authority safeguarding being involved our complaint about their care was also followed up by the LGSCO. Many of the carers employed by Forest View are committed and show kindness and compassion towards the residents and the chef cooks some nice meals, so we have respect for a lot of the staff and the work that they do. We are very happy now that our loved one is able to live where their health has improved and we can see what a good care home looks like; it is worth paying a little more to make sure your loved one is well cared for.
